JOB DESCRIPTION
Develops and improves plating processes in support of operations. Works with Quality, Sales and other functions to implement new production processes and improve existing production processes.
JOB REQUIREMENTS
- Work independently to manage projects and assignments.
- Lead project teams to complete assigned projects on time and under budget.
- Develop key interdepartmental relationships with Operations, Quality Assurance, Sales and customers to effectively expedite orders to satisfy the company’s commitment to 100% customer satisfaction.
- Prioritize and manage multiple tasks simultaneously and complete within required timelines.
- Read, understand and develop operational reports, schedules, and other reports.
- Additional duties as required.
RESPONSIBILITIES
Quality
- Ensure all assigned processes and related activities are performed in compliance with Company quality policies and other plant quality certifications.
- Coach and train associates on best practices to yield conforming parts.
- Lead troubleshooting and problem-solving initiatives with platers, quality engineer, and other support functions. Use 8D problem solving and statistical methods whenever possible.
- Interact with customer engineering or quality functions to resolve problems.
- Assist quality department with internal and external audit preparation as required.
Safety and Environmental Stewardship
- Ensure all assigned processes and related activities are performed safely in compliance with company policies and federal, state and local regulations.
- Coach and train associates on best practices to complete a task safely.
- Report all safety and environmental incidents to plant leadership in a timely manner.
Project Management
- Manage assigned projects in the following areas: New product introduction – new customer products in existing processes.
New process introduction – new metal finishing process for operations.Existing process improvement – existing processes/customer products with the potential for improvement in throughput, quality or cost.
- Manage all projects using sound project management practices including: Form and lead cross-functional teams including platers and line operators.
Develop written project plans.Conduct regular project meetings.Submit written summary of project notes and lessons learned at the completion of projects.
QUALIFICATIONS:
· Bachelor of Science degree in Engineering, Chemistry, Physics or equivalent.
· 1 – 3 years of manufacturing engineering experience; plating experience desired.
· Basic computer skills; proficient with Microsoft Office.
· Excellent organization and communication skills.
